The Minister of Education, Dr Olatunji Alausa, has said President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has fulfilled almost 100 per cent of the promises contained in his 2023 presidential campaign manifesto.

Alausa made the declaration in Abuja at the weekend while receiving the outcomes of the 2025 Nigeria 2050: Child Foresight Analysis for Futures Literacy and Intergenerational Equity, a flagship initiative of the Anticipatory Governance and Foresight Capacity Programme of the Office of the Vice President, implemented with technical support from the United Nations Children’s Fund.

According to the minister, the country has moved beyond the uncertainty that previously characterised national development, with the administration now recording tangible reforms and changes across different sectors.

“These are not just rhetorics we are hearing now. These are things we are seeing, with a lot of tangible benefits and tangible change in the country,” Alausa said.

He said the progress recorded under the administration was particularly evident in the education sector, where the Federal Ministry of Education is implementing reforms under the Renewed Hope Agenda.

Alausa said the Nigerian Education Sector Renewal Initiative was driving reforms in technical and vocational education and training, STEM education, teacher quality, quality assurance, reduction of out-of-school children, education data and digitalisation.

He also said the Federal Government was expanding access to medical education and professional training to address shortages of nurses and other health professionals, adding that existing teaching hospitals, federal medical centres and specialist hospitals were being used to increase training capacity.

On the controversial estimates of Nigeria’s out-of-school children, the minister said the government had adopted a data-driven approach to determine the actual number of affected children.

He questioned estimates putting the figure between 15 million and 17 million, saying recent household surveys in some states had produced significantly lower figures.

Alausa cited Kaduna State, where a household survey covering more than 90 per cent of households reportedly recorded fewer than 190,000 out-of-school children, compared with an earlier estimate of about 585,000.

He said more than one million children had been moved from the streets into schools nationwide over the past two and a half years, while Jigawa State alone had reportedly enrolled more than 180,000 children within two years.

The minister, however, said the priority remained ensuring that children remained in school and preventing fresh cases of school exclusion.

“Even if there’s significant reduction, any child out of school is still too many,” he said.

Alausa further disclosed that more than 56 per cent of public schools and 41 per cent of private schools had submitted their 2026 Annual School Census information through the digitised Nigerian Education Management Information System.

He said accurate education data would enable the government to identify gaps, plan infrastructure, target interventions and measure the impact of reforms.
